Output e62223a899f4db169618950265148960bec97e300667c30b0bcf9ef7c7e35b00:3

value
1180591
script pubkey
OP_0 OP_PUSHBYTES_20 bc1f0d783cccd70c450a1e3be3632ac65f4b1ae3
address
bc1qhs0s67puentsc3g2rca7xce2ce05kxhr49ra2x
transaction
e62223a899f4db169618950265148960bec97e300667c30b0bcf9ef7c7e35b00
confirmations
387739
spent
true